Director, P&C Technology

Zelis Healthcare, LLC
United States, New Jersey, Morristown
Mar 14, 2025

The Director of People & Culture (P&C) Technology is responsible for managing the daily operations and workload of the P&C Technology team. This role requires being a player/coach and will have significant involvement in executing tasks that support the strategic roadmap of Workday and other relevant people technologies. This role will partner closely with global P&C leaders across the functional and business partnering teams as well as other business, finance and corporate technology stakeholders.

Key Responsibilities

  • Leads process improvement and automation initiatives, development and enhancement of existing technology to improve processes that reduce complexity and cost.

  • Leads the Workday strategy and continued adoption consulting for people and processes enabled by technology.

  • Builds, maintains and directs the roadmap for delivering innovative and automated solutions while analyzing detailed business requirements and specifications needed.

  • Leads a team of direct reports with multiple projects, deliverables and aggressive deadlines.

  • Coaches, reviews and delegates work to team while continuing to facilitate team development and growth.

  • Serves as program manager, overseeing multiple projects including planning, testing, deployment, ongoing maintenance, and technology evolution, responding to scope changes and continued enhancement requests.

  • Interacts with executive leadership and others concerning matters of significance to the organization and makes decisions that have a considerable impact on the overall success of our technology.

  • Manages large projects and is acknowledged as the authority on P&C technology, particularly Workday. Requires being a player/coach, with ability to deliver innovative solutions to complex problems.

  • Builds and maintains relevant relationships with stakeholders while communicating with cross functional teams (P&C, legal, finance, IT) and monitoring prompt response and support for technical issues.

Work Experience

  • 6-8 years required; 10+ years preferred

Qualifications

  • 5+ years of Workday experience with multiple implementations and production support across HCM, Recruiting, Benefits, Payroll, Time & Absence, Talent, Compensation, and Learning.

  • Demonstrates extensive hands-on ability and proven success with managing configuration of the full suite of Workday HCM solutions.

  • Ability to successfully work on multiple projects, work streams and aggressive deadlines.

  • Workday Pro certification(s) and Project Management certification(s) preferred.

Zelis is modernizing the healthcare financial experience by providing a connected platform that bridges the gaps and aligns interests across payers, providers, and healthcare consumers. This platform serves more than 750 payers, including the top 5 national health plans, BCBS insurers, regional health plans, TPAs and self-insured employers, and millions of healthcare providers and consumers. Zelis sees across the system to identify, optimize, and solve problems holistically with technology built by healthcare experts - driving real, measurable results for clients.
